diff options
Diffstat (limited to 'c-user')
-rw-r--r-- | c-user/symmetric_multiprocessing_services.rst |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/c-user/symmetric_multiprocessing_services.rst b/c-user/symmetric_multiprocessing_services.rst index ab5e1be..e04adb3 100644 --- a/c-user/symmetric_multiprocessing_services.rst +++ b/c-user/symmetric_multiprocessing_services.rst @@ -302,6 +302,14 @@ of the OpenMP master thread that created it. In the scheduler instance ``WRK1`` there are three thread pools available and their worker threads run at priority four. +Atomic Operations +----------------- + +There is no public RTEMS API for atomic operations. It is recommended to use +the standard C `<stdatomic.h> <https://en.cppreference.com/w/c/atomic>`_ or C++ +`<atomic> <https://en.cppreference.com/w/cpp/atomic/atomic>`_ APIs in +applications. + Application Issues ================== |